Midland Woman Accused Of Driving Drunk With 4 Young Children In Vehicle

MIDLAND -- A Midland woman is accused of driving drunk with four young children in her vehicle.

    Vanessa Marie Chavana was arrested on February 20th.

    Midland Police say that Chavana, 24, drove drunk while 4 young children were in her vehicle around 12:20 AM on February 20th.

    Chavana's friend was also reportedly in the vehicle at the time, and she allegedly got into an argument with Chavana.

    Chavana reportedly pulled over in the 4300 block of Bedford Avenue, and officers say that the two women nearly came to blows outside the vehicle.

    Police responded to a disturbance call in connection with the fight, and officers reportedly noticed that Chavana looked drunk,

    Chavana was arrested after she subsequently failed field sobriety tests.

    Now, Chavana is charged with 2 counts of D.W.I. with children under the age of 15 in the vehicle, 2 counts of driving with an invalid license and outstanding warrants.
   
    As of Friday evening, Chavana was being held in the Midland County Detention Center on $50,000 bond.
